What Love Does (1 Cor. 13:4-8) Posted: 08 Jan 2010 05:07 AM PST Read 1 Corinthians 13:4-8. Look at each individual aspect of what love is and ask, How can I apply these principles in my own home?    Love is patient       Often times we find ourselves losing our patience in different    situations. To keep our patience we may need to pause take a    deep breath and ask God's help in whatever situation.       Does not envy       Often time we are envious because we are not content with what    God has given us. We must take time to reflect on the things    God has blessed us with and not the things we do not have.       Love is kind       This is something that must be practiced. We may have a way of    expressing ourselves which people perceive differently than    we do. We must ask for peoples input and , also look at the    example of Christ.       Does not boast       No one likes a person who boasts, we must ask for Gods humility    because all that we have is as a result of His blessing.       It is not rude       This one deals with how you treat people. This also relates to    kindness.       Not self-seeking       We should not seek to our only interests but the interests of    others.       Not easily angered       This is something which also goes with personality at times. But    if you develop the other characteristics such as patience it will    help with this aspect.       Rejoices with the truth       When I think of love , it does not revel in lies and deception    it rejoice in things which are true sincere and honest. This is    the things that love focuses on and meditates on.       Always protects       Love has a protective nature to it. I think of a mothers love it    is something which always seeks to protect the child and to    make sure that they are ok. Love has a deep concern for a    individuals well being and safety.       Not proud       This can be applied to your home by the types of interactions    that exist in the home. Sometimes arguments are started because    a person is to proud to admit they are wrong or ask for help    or forgiveness. But seeking the humility of Christ it will help    to show love in the home.       Always trusts       To always trust can bee seen in many ways in the relationship.    When you trust an individual you are confident in their ability.    Confidence in their ability is an act of love which lets them    know that you value who they are as a person.       Always hopes       In the home it is good to have a an attitude of hope. Hope is    something which will lighten the load of life's burdens. It    helps to to bring a peaceful atmosphere to the home.       Always perseveres       I see this is something which is similar to hope, perseverance    keeps moving forward. No matter how the things may appear love    continues to press on. In the home this is necessary to    deal with life ,and having this attitude is an asset to any    relationships       Love never fails       This is a powerful statement. If your home life is seasoned    with love that means that there can be no failure. I think in    loving there are returns which are guaranteed. Love has a power    which can change , and bring results.
